The Opportunity:
We are seeking an experienced Release & Change Management Specialist to support our program with the Department of Veterans Affairs (VA).  Our ideal candidate will be responsible for managing software releases and change control processes in a complex federal financial enterprise resource planning (ERP) system environment.  This position will play a crucial role in ensuring smooth and controlled software releases while adhering to government standards and processes. Successful candidate will work closely with various teams to coordinate and implement changes effectively.

Responsibilities:

  • Support end-to-end release management processes, including planning, scheduling, coordination, and deployment across all environments (dev, test, staging, production)
  • Govern and execute change management activities, ensuring all changes to the operational baseline are properly reviewed, approved, and documented
  • Manage release calendars and coordinate with cross-functional teams to ensure alignment of deployments with business priorities and system availability windows
  • Oversee deployment execution, including validation, post-deployment verification, and coordination of rollback procedures when necessary
  • Ensure all configuration, schema, code, and data changes are properly version-controlled, documented, and synchronized across environments
  • Coordinate with Agile teams to integrate release activities with sprint cycles, epics, and features in the Integrated Project Schedule
  • Facilitate release readiness reviews/meetings
  • Track and report on release status, risks, issues, and dependencies to leadership
  • Ensure compliance with VA configuration management (CM) processes and standards
  • Collaborate with teams to ensure successful integration and deployment of system components
  • Identify and implement process improvements to enhance release efficiency, quality, and predictability
  • Support incident management related to releases, including root cause analysis and corrective actions


Qualifications:
Required: 

  • Bachelor’s degree in Computer Science, Information Technology, or related field
  • 5+ years of experience in release management, change management, or DevOps in a complex enterprise environment
  • Experience managing releases for ERP systems (preferably Momentum or similar federal financial systems)
  • Strong understanding of change management and configuration management processes in a federal environment
  • Proven ability to manage multiple concurrent releases and priorities
  • Strong communication skills, with experience interfacing with technical teams and government stakeholders


Desired:

  • Experience supporting VA systems, Momentum Financials, or federal financial management environments.
  • Familiarity with tools such as Jira, Agility, ServiceNow, Azure DevOps, or similar for release and change tracking.
  • Experience working in Agile environments and coordinating with Scrum teams.

About CACI International

CACI International Inc is a multinational professional services and information technology company. It provides services to many branches of the federal government including defense, homeland security, intelligence, and healthcare. CACI has approximately 23,000 employees worldwide. The company's mission is to provide enterprise and mission technology services and solutions that best fit the needs of its customers.
